Transaction e6066879e62a3d523e35811af14157053a912b895fc8e0c20182e4eb105b0638
1 Input
1 Output
-
e6066879e62a3d523e35811af14157053a912b895fc8e0c20182e4eb105b0638:0
- value
- 167299
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1172232dc28e22da99db0e7b5b72c7ba0503a75
- address
- bc1qkytjyvku9r3zm2vakrnmtdev0ws9qwn4t97mp8